"In Him, you also, after listening to the message of truth, the gospel of your salvation—having also believed, you were sealed in Him with the Holy Spirit of promise."
(Eph. 1:13 NASB)



When you heard the good news of your salvation and believed it, you were sealed with the Holy Spirit of promise. The word "sealed" means to stamp with a signet or private mark. It means to fasten us up by the Holy Spirit and keep us as a top-secret prize, safe from the enemy.

The Message Bible says: "It's in Christ that you, once you heard the truth and believed it (this Message of your salvation), found yourselves home free—signed, sealed, and delivered by the Holy Spirit."

It's because you heard and believed the message of truth and put your faith in Christ that you were given the promised Holy Spirit to show everyone that you belong to God. God put His stamp of ownership and approval on you, giving you the Holy Spirit, and now you can live for Him according to the promise.
